Understanding ClickBank Traffic in 2026

ClickBank's marketplace connects product vendors with affiliate marketers, offering commissions typically ranging from 50% to 75% per sale. With average order values (AOV) on top products reaching $120โ€“$200+, even modest traffic volumes can generate meaningful income when paired with the right advertising strategy.

The key metric for evaluating any traffic source is Earnings Per Click (EPC) โ€” how much you earn for every person who clicks your affiliate link. If a ClickBank product pays a $75 commission and converts at 2%, your EPC is $1.50. Any advertising channel that delivers clicks for less than your EPC is profitable.

๐Ÿ’ก Key Formula: If your EPC exceeds your Cost Per Click (CPC), you're profitable. Always know your EPC before spending on paid traffic. ClickBank displays average EPC data for each product in the Marketplace stats โ€” use it as a baseline, then track your own results.

1. Facebook Ads for ClickBank Products

Facebook remains one of the most popular paid traffic sources for ClickBank affiliates in 2026. Its granular targeting options let you reach specific demographics, interests, and behaviors โ€” ideal for products with clearly defined audiences like weight loss supplements (adults 40+), relationship guides (singles 25โ€“45), or financial products (entrepreneurs).

How to Structure Your Campaign

Budget & Benchmarks (2026 Data)

  • Typical CPC: $0.50โ€“$2.50 (varies by niche; health/fitness is most competitive)
  • Recommended starting budget: $20โ€“$50/day for testing
  • Break-even timeline: 2โ€“4 weeks of testing to find profitable angles
  • Best-performing niches: Health & Fitness, E-business, Self-Help

2. Google Ads (Search & Display)

Google Ads can deliver highly targeted traffic because you're reaching people actively searching for solutions. However, Google's advertising policies are stricter than Facebook's, particularly around health claims, making money promises, and affiliate links.

Strategy for ClickBank Affiliates

โš ๏ธ Google Ads Policy Warning: Google strictly enforces policies against misleading health claims and income promises. Never use ad copy like "Lose 30 pounds in 30 days" or "Make $10,000 this week." Focus on honest, benefit-oriented messaging that aligns with the product's actual claims.

3. Native Advertising (Taboola, Outbrain, MGID)

Native ads appear as recommended content on news sites and blogs. They work well for ClickBank products because they blend editorial content with advertising, and readers discover products in a context that feels organic.

Choosing the Right Products to Advertise

Your advertising strategy means nothing if you're promoting the wrong product. Here's how to evaluate ClickBank products before investing time or money into advertising them:

Key Metrics to Check

Metric What It Means Good Range
Gravity Score Number of unique affiliates making sales in the past 90 days 10โ€“100+ (higher = more proven demand)
Avg $/Sale Average commission per sale (including upsells) $30+ for paid traffic viability
Avg %/Sale Commission percentage 50โ€“75% (standard for digital products)
Avg $/Rebill Recurring commission from subscription products Any (bonus revenue over time)
Refund Rate Percentage of sales refunded (not shown directly; infer from gravity/EPC gap) Under 15% is healthy

Building a Presell Funnel

The most successful ClickBank advertisers rarely send traffic directly to a vendor's sales page. Instead, they build a presell funnel โ€” a landing page that warms up the visitor, addresses objections, and builds trust before forwarding them to the ClickBank offer.

Anatomy of an Effective Presell Page

  1. Attention-grabbing headline: Address the visitor's pain point or desired outcome immediately.
  2. Relatable story or hook: Share a personal experience, case study, or surprising fact that resonates with the visitor's situation.
  3. Product introduction: Present the ClickBank product as the solution, highlighting key benefits (not just features).
  4. Social proof: Include testimonials, before/after results, or credibility markers.
  5. Address objections: Proactively answer common concerns ("Is it safe?" "What if it doesn't work?" "How fast will I see results?").
  6. Clear call to action: A prominent button or link directing to the ClickBank product page with benefit-focused copy like "See How It Works" or "Get Started Today."
  7. FTC disclosure: Always include a clear affiliate disclosure on your presell page.

Common Advertising Mistakes to Avoid

โŒ Mistakes That Kill Campaigns

  • Direct-linking to ClickBank products: Most ad platforms ban or penalize this. Always use a presell page or review site.
  • Ignoring FTC compliance: Failing to disclose affiliate relationships can result in fines up to $50,120 per violation. Always include clear disclosures.
  • Promoting products you haven't researched: If the product is low-quality or has a high refund rate, your advertising spend is wasted regardless of how good your ads are.
  • Targeting too broadly: "Everyone" is not your audience. Pick a specific demographic and message that resonates with them.
  • Giving up too early: Most successful campaigns require 1โ€“3 weeks of testing before they become profitable. Set a testing budget and commit to iterating.
  • Not tracking results: If you can't measure it, you can't improve it. Set up tracking before launching any campaign.

Putting It All Together: A Sample Strategy

Here's a realistic approach for a new ClickBank affiliate starting in 2026 with a modest budget:

๐ŸŒฑ The Bootstrap Strategy (Low Budget)

  1. Weeks 1โ€“4: Build a review site (like this one!) with 5โ€“10 product review pages. Focus on SEO fundamentals and genuine, helpful content.
  2. Weeks 4โ€“8: Start creating YouTube review videos for your top 3 products. Publish 2โ€“3 videos per week.
  3. Weeks 8โ€“12: Add email capture to your site. Create a lead magnet related to your niche and start building your list.
  4. Month 4+: Once you have organic traffic and some commission data, reinvest earnings into Facebook Ads for your top-converting product. Start with $10โ€“$20/day and scale what works.

๐Ÿ’ฐ The Accelerated Strategy (Paid Budget)

  1. Week 1: Research and select 2โ€“3 high-gravity ClickBank products with proven EPCs above $1.50. Build presell pages for each.
  2. Week 2: Launch Facebook Ad campaigns with 3โ€“5 ad variations per product. Budget: $30โ€“$50/day total across all campaigns.
  3. Week 3: Analyze results. Kill ads with CPC above $2.00 or CTR below 1%. Double down on winning angles.
  4. Week 4+: Scale profitable campaigns. Add retargeting to capture visitors who didn't convert on the first visit. Expand to native ads or Google Ads for diversification.
